About Baghjap Village
Baghjap is a mid sized village in Mayong tehsil, in the district of Morigaon, Assam.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 974, made up of 480 males and 494 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,029 females per 1000 males. The village covers 195.24 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 782410,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Baghjap
The census records public bus service for Baghjap as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
